Long story short I haven't owned an e30 for about two years after being rear ended in my Euro bumpered 325 coupe, but I have been hoarding parts for awhile and had plans to get another e30. So one Friday morning, anticipating a long boring summer ahead of me, I was looking through offerup of all things and found this nice little gem. Contacted the seller, met up with him the next day and brought the car home.
1991 Lagunengrun 325i
145k miles
Automatic
Paint is peeling and fading
Sat for 8 years in a hangar and 2 outside
Doesn't start - told a tested and known faulty starter was the issue
Progess may be a little slow on this due to lack of tools, but I'll be using this thread to update as I go along. I know r3v likes pictures so here's some from the first day I picked her up.
